    Seems like that’s not too much room for luggage case companies to reinvent the wheel. Bound by the size and weight adhering to different airlines traveling rules, similar form format - wheel, retractable handles. I am using the large 4 wheelers from Lojel. 3 clam type of securing the closures which I prefer over zipper for durability and security. TSA locks. Also more water resistant too. Lojel has all the handles, locks all flushed along the luggage sides - not sticking out like many brands that could be prone to damage during transport exposing to throwing, dropping, rubbing against something. The wheels have no stopper which I don’t see the need, but it’s silent and easy to push or drag even on soft carpet. They are build tough, hasn’t break for 8 years. I always favour polycarbonate (?) over soft fabric. Aluminum could dent and won’t bounce back to shape, no. Durable, still light and water resistant.

    @CarlHancock2 ай бұрын

    Alumunum Rimowa Cabin case. Dial up the price point. I'll tell you why... the best warranty out there, great wheels, good balance for when placing your backup on top of it, and a clamshell design is better than a zipper design. Having used zipper design and clamshell clamp designs I've found zippers to be a weak point in the design. I highly recommend a hardshell carry-on roller rather than a softshell. I can't stress enough how handy it is to have a hardshell in order to protect items that you need extra protection fro. And sometimes you don't realize you need extra protection for something until you are in the middle of the trip and decide to buy something. Expensive?Absolutely. I've used a Rimow Cabin case for years and any time I had any kind of issue I took it to the Rimowa store and they had it taken care of. I had a retractable handle bend (my fault... with a loaded backup on it I lifted it up by the end of the handle with it fully ended and the end of the case with both fully loaded and I did that too rough and too often and it eventually bent a bit and caused issues reliably retracting the handle. Took it to the Rimowa store. Fixed. More recently I had one of the latches break which prevented me from latching it closed. Luckily with the handle design a bag strap/buckle wrapped around it and I could use it to get through my trip no problem. Again, took it to the Rimowa store... fixed. No questions asked. I've tried using a wide variety of bags mentioned here. As well as things like the Away carry on case, and even more recently the Db (formerly known as D_____ B___ use your imagination) carry on roller which I did like... but nothing has topped the Rimowa.
